The above circuit uses two firstorder filters connected or cascaded together to form a secondorder or twopole high pass network. These blocks are capable of calculating filter coefficients for various filter structures. Set the sampling frequency and the desired number of taps. I would always recommend simulating the software generated filter with real life. Having previously written my own software to design eplane filters, i find eseptum to be fast, and flexible. You can also compare filters using the filter visualization tool and design. Filter design made simpler with filter designguide youtube. The response of the filter is displayed on graphs, showing bode diagram, nyquist diagram, impulse response and step response. If you set rc to 1, and enter the butterworth values of a from the table above, you will see the butterworth maximally flat amplitude response, with cut. The bessel filter sometimes called the thomson filter is optimized to provide a constant group delay in the filter passband, while sacrificing sharpness in the magnitude response. In this video, well look at how adss filter designguide can quickly set up filter.
Filter design software category is a curation of 17 web resources on, couplings designer, nuhertz technologies, aktivfilter. Hf filter design 8 active rc integrators cont the rc integrator shown previously in not very suitable for monolithic realization because the time constant ti ricint cannot be tuned after realization. Digital logic design is a software tool for designing and simulating digital circuits. Active low pass filter circuit design and applications. This is important because otherwise it is a high pass filter. You can guess and check until the filter matches your expected bandwidth and cutoff requirements, but this could be a long and tedious process. Note that c and r can only be fabricated with an accuracy of 20% and 5% respectively. If you need to design this type of filter, in my opinion eseptum is the tool of choice.
It will synthesize linear phase or minimum phase filters and fractional. This page is the index of web calculator that design and analysis analog filters. Proprietary websites may only use components that are produced by. Using a simple test cm filter, measure the cm noise spectrum with and without filter. Lowpass attenuation curve in fig 11 you can see that everything is fine and perfect until we reach the hp p halfpower point corresponding to f c the cutoff frequency. Passive lc, crystal and microwave filters active rc and switchedcapacitor filter digital filters of both iir and fir variety. Therefore, the term rc low pass is common, where the r stands for the resistor and the c for the capacitor. Design and implement a filter design a digital filter in simulink. Select chebyshev, elliptic, butterworth or bessel filter type, with filter order up to 20, and arbitrary input and output impedances. Combining a passive rc filter with an op amp for amplification creates what is known as an active filter. Just by adding an additional rc circuit to the first order low pass filter the circuit behaves as a second order filter. This page is a web application that design a rc lowpass filter. This is the last known release of aades filter design application for windows, mirrored for posterity as permitted by the programs license agreement.
Easy design of lowpass filters once the filterpro program is started, several parameters must be entered to design a lowpass filter. So, lets say i have this stream of data coming in to my system and i need to average it out. Design multiband complex fir filters of the following types. Im sure this could be written in other software languages as well, just dont ask me how. Moving on, as the title says, this post is about how to write a digital lowpass filter using the c language. Passive band pass filter circuit design and applications. In this video, we will perform the ac simulation of simple low pass filters. The resulting secondorder high pass filter circuit will have a slope of 40dbdecade 12dboctave. The position of the resistor and capacitor are switched to change from low pass to high pass but the same calculation applies to both filters. A simple digital lowpass filter in c kirit chatterjee. Filterlab filter design software microchip technology.
That is when our filter starts working, because its purpose is to cut all frequencies greater than f c fig 12. I use microcap and there is a student version available. You can use series and parallel rlc circuits to create bandpass and bandreject filters. A comprehensive webbased user interface simplifies common administration tasks. The pole frequency is approximately equals to the frequency of the maximum gain. Tutorial 5 design a low pass filter in ads youtube. My colleagues use ltspice because it is free but, when i want to go straight for values in things like sallen key opamp filters or lcr filters i use this webpage from okawa they do rc, rl, rlc 3 types, sallen key hp and lp 2nd and 3rd order with and without gain and multiple feedback filters 2nd and 3rd order covers most folks. Calculate the maximum and minimum values of cm noise source. On page five of our filter tool you will see how you can vary a and rc of onestage, oneandahalf stage, and twostage active filter to create a two, three, and fourpole lowpass filters. The circuit working can be analyzed by using output parts like leds, seven segment display and. Free filter calculators, active filter design, chebyshev.
Cm and dm noise separation using a noise separator. If the time constant is short durational the filter will produce differentiated square wave. Then a firstorder filter stage can be converted into a secondorder type by simply using an additional rc network, the same as for the 2 ndorder low pass filter. In this software, circuit can easily be converted into a reusable module. In this tutorial we will look at the simplest type, a passive two component rc low pass filter. Active filter design software for lowpass, highpass, bandpass and bandstop electronic filters using resistors, capacitors and op amps. Passive filters take up lots of space in a circuit and cause signal to be lost. Also examined are t wo types of lpfs in the context of attenuated voltagereference noise. Design active filters with real op amps in minutes. Typically, in fir filter design the length of the filter will need to be specified. The two components filter out very high and very low. By active we mean that the filter requires power to operate.
The resistance of the capacitor increases with decreasing frequency and vice versa. With filtercad, you can design lowpass, highpass, bandpass and notch filters. Because there are instances where the sallenkey filter topology is a better choice, the user can specify. Use this utility to calculate the transfer function for filters at a given frequency or values of r and c. We can also design a band pass filter with inductors, but we know that due to high reactance of the capacitors the band pass filter design with rc elements is more advantage than rl circuits. If we feed square wave and the provide the it on a perfect time domain the output wave form of the filter produce spikes or short duration pulse. The cutoff frequency, number of poles, filter type, and filter configuration are the main inputs. A simple passive rc low pass filter or lpf, can be easily. Lc filters design tool calculate lc filters circuit values with lowpass, highpass, bandpass, or bandstop response. Its simple filter specification editor allows you to easily design. An rc highpass filter is created by the series connection of the two components, whereby the output voltage is tapped above the ohmic resistance. Filterlab is an innovative software tool that simplifies active filter design. Filterlab is an easy tool that allows you to design low pass, high pass, and band pass filters, showing the schematic diagram of a filter circuit.
Rlc series bandpass filter bpf you can get a bandpass. Rc filter calculator how rc filters work electronicbase. How to design and simulate low pass filter in pspice lets design a simple circuit of a buck converter which is to be discussed in this tutorial and the boost converter with a few details provided is left for you as an exercise. Open the pspice design manager on your pc by typing design manager in the search bar. Designing a band pass lc filter is almost a lost art today as most of these filters are built with ceramic resonators, and for the obvious reason, size. The simple rc filter rolls off the frequency response at 6 db per octave above the cutoff frequency. Digital filter design applets and dsp tutorials each filter design tool is a java applet which provides an interactive design method and a frequency response. Rc filter cutoff frequency calculator electronic products. An rc filter cutoff frequency calculator would be very useful here. An rlc circuit has a resistor, inductor, and capacitor connected in series or in parallel. Scopefir is the premiere software tool for finite impulse response fir filter design.
Scopefir can design filters, hilbert transformers, or differentiators. Link synopsis scopefir fir filter design software for windows tfilter a web application for designing linearphase fir filters scopeiir iir filter design tool for windows digital signal processing tutorial java applets for digital filter design. We perform these simulations using the simulation instrument. Bessel filters are sometimes used in applications where a constant group delay is critical, such as in analog video signal processing. It uses a pure javascript implementation of the parksmcclellan filter design algorithm. Calculate the required attenuation along with definite regulations. Nethserver is an operating system for linux enthusiasts, designed for small offices and medium enterprises. The filter design tool lets you design, optimize, and simulate complete multistage active filter solutions within minutes.
This free rf filter program specializes in the design of lc band pass filters, but it also synthesizes low pass, high pass, and notch filters. Low pass filter design and simulation using pspice. Are there good free software analog filter design tools. There are many applications for an rlc circuit, including bandpass filters, bandreject filters, and lowhighpass filters. The most flexible and powerful microwave and rf filter and multiplexer design software prof.
The socalled butterworth filter simply consists of an inductor with which a capacitor is connected in series. Use software filters to reduce adc noise electronic design. This is the simplest way to build a bandpass filter. You can smooth a signal, remove outliers, or use interactive tools such as filter design and analysis tool to design and analyze various fir and iir filters. It uses three separate methods to synthesize filters, parks mcclellan, rectangular window impulse, and frequency domain sampling. A module may be used to built more complex circuits like cpu. Provides butterworth, chebyshev, elliptic and bessel approximations to order 10, with a variety of circuit choices. Common characteristics all segments can handle lowpass, highpass, bandpass and bandreject filters, delay lines of degree up to 50 and up to 20 additional delay. Calculate lc filters circuit values with lowpass, highpass, bandpass, or bandstop response. The simplest low pass filters consist of a resistor and capacitor but more sophisticated low pass filters have a combination of series inductors and parallel capacitors. The performance and sensitivity analysis functions are especially useful. Filter design software category is a curation of 17 web resources on, couplings. The rc bandpass calculator makes it easy for anyone to build a bandpass filter. The filter design tool lets you design, optimize, and simulate complete.
You can design lowpass, highpass, bandpass, and bandstop filters using either the digital filter design block or the filter realization wizard. I dont have the source code to this program, and i have no relationship with aade or neil hechts estate besides being a very. Fir filter design, software and examples digital filter. The first order low pass filter consists of a resistor and a capacitor connected in series. The equation below is an efficient way to compute a reasonable starting length. We can differentiate a signal using this property of high pass.
136 16 971 346 1606 25 958 1038 525 1030 693 406 413 151 755 195 1497 45 784 1254 1473 401 1063 1446 396 335 634 978 786 314 105 1463 1372 349 1205 1446